Activating the Picture Mode
This TV o ers the choice of personalising the picture
style.
Intelligent AutoView, Dynamic, Standard and
Theater are preset options and a ect many
features/settings within the TV.
To use the q button
1 Press q to view the di erent modes
available.
To use the Menu
1 From the PICTURE menu, press or to
select Picture Settings and press OK.

3 Press or to select your desired Picture
Mode.
NOTE:
The Picture Mode you select a ects the current
input only. You can select a di erent Picture Mode
for each input.
Activating the picture preferences
You can customise current Picture Mode settings as
desired. For example, while selecting "Dynamic", if
you change the following items, such as Backlight,
Contrast, Brightness, Colour, Tint, Sharpness, and
the Picture Settings items, your new setting are
saved for "Dynamic" Picture Mode.
1 From the Picture Settings menu, press
or to select either Backlight, Contrast,
Brightness, Colour, Tint or Sharpness.
2 Press or to adjust the settings as desired.
Using the picture still
Press to freeze the picture.
Even if an image is frozen on the TV screen, the
pictures are running on the input source. Audio
continues to be output as well.
To return to a moving picture, press
again.

Using the Intelligent Scene Optimizer
You can easily select the best picture and sound
mode for what you are watching.
Sound is a ected when the Sound Mode is set to
Auto (- page 24).
1 Press .
The Intelligent Scene Optimizer window will
appear at the bottom of the screen.
2 Press or to select the best mode for what
you are watching, and press OK.
• Auto mode automatically sets the best picture
and sound mode for what you are watching.
The modes that can be selected di er
according to the input and what you are
watching.
NOTE:
The Intelligent Scene Optimizer you select a ects
the current input only. You can select a di erent
Intelligent Scene Optimizer for each input.
